Also on &lt;/FONT&gt;&lt;SPAN style="COLOR: #c00000"&gt;&lt;STRONG&gt;Friday&lt;/STRONG&gt;&lt;/SPAN&gt;&lt;FONT color=#000000&gt; he would read &lt;/FONT&gt;&lt;SPAN style="COLOR: #c00000"&gt;&lt;STRONG&gt;surah Kahf&lt;/STRONG&gt;&lt;/SPAN&gt;&lt;FONT color=#000000&gt; and &lt;/FONT&gt;&lt;SPAN style="COLOR: #c00000"&gt;&lt;STRONG&gt;Ta-ha&lt;/STRONG&gt;&lt;/SPAN&gt;&lt;FONT color=#000000&gt; among others things on Friday and after zuhr reciting &lt;/FONT&gt;&lt;SPAN style="COLOR: #c00000"&gt;&lt;STRONG&gt;1,000 laelaha-ill-lallah&lt;/STRONG&gt;&lt;/SPAN&gt;&lt;FONT color=#000000&gt; and doubling the number in the &lt;/FONT&gt;&lt;SPAN style="COLOR: #c00000"&gt;month of Ramadhan&lt;/SPAN&gt;&lt;FONT color=#000000&gt; thus 2,000 and read into the first 5 days of Shawal so to total &lt;/FONT&gt;&lt;SPAN style="COLOR: #c00000"&gt;&lt;STRONG&gt;70,000 laelaha-ill-lallah&lt;/STRONG&gt;&lt;/SPAN&gt;&lt;FONT color=#000000&gt;, the number which is said to bring &lt;/FONT&gt;&lt;/FONT&gt;&lt;A href="http://www.deenislam.co.uk/me/dead.htm"&gt;&lt;FONT color=#0000ff face=Arial&gt;salvation from the hell fire for oneself or on behalf of the decreased&lt;/FONT&gt;&lt;/A&gt;&lt;FONT color=#000000&gt;&lt;FONT face=Arial&gt; who it is done for.&lt;o:p&gt;&lt;/o:p&gt;&lt;/FONT&gt;&lt;/FONT&gt;&lt;/SPAN&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P style="TEXT-ALIGN: justify; MARGIN: 0cm 0cm 10pt" class=MsoNormal&gt;&lt;SPAN style="LINE-HEIGHT: 115%; FONT-FAMILY: 'Trebuchet MS','sans-serif'; FONT-SIZE: 10pt" lang=EN-US&gt;&lt;o:p&gt;&lt;FONT color=#000000 face=Arial&gt;&lt;/FONT&gt;&lt;/o:p&gt;&lt;/SPAN&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P style="TEXT-ALIGN: justify; MARGIN: 0cm 0cm 10pt" class=MsoNormal&gt;&lt;SPAN&gt;&lt;STRONG&gt;&lt;FONT size=2&gt;&lt;FONT face=Arial&gt;salat al-Ishraq&lt;o:p&gt;&lt;/o:p&gt;&lt;/FONT&gt;&lt;/FONT&gt;&lt;/STRONG&gt;&lt;/SPAN&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P style="TEXT-ALIGN: justify; MARGIN: 0cm 0cm 10pt" class=MsoNormal&gt;&lt;SPAN&gt;&lt;FONT size=2&gt;&lt;FONT face=Arial&gt;&lt;STRONG&gt;Note:&lt;/STRONG&gt;&lt;FONT color=#000000&gt; about the &lt;/FONT&gt;&lt;SPAN&gt;&lt;STRONG&gt;salat al-Ishraq&lt;/STRONG&gt;-the Sunrise prayer&lt;/SPAN&gt;&lt;FONT color=#000000&gt;, its &lt;/FONT&gt;&lt;SPAN style="COLOR: #c00000"&gt;4 rakah&lt;/SPAN&gt;&lt;FONT color=#000000&gt;, which is read in &lt;/FONT&gt;&lt;SPAN style="COLOR: #c00000"&gt;2 rakah each&lt;/SPAN&gt;&lt;FONT color=#000000&gt;, the time for &lt;/FONT&gt;&lt;SPAN style="COLOR: #c00000"&gt;&lt;STRONG&gt;Ishraq is 15-20mins after sunrise&lt;/STRONG&gt;&lt;/SPAN&gt;&lt;FONT color=#000000&gt;. Hadith ‘&lt;/FONT&gt;&lt;I style="mso-bidi-font-style: normal"&gt;&lt;SPAN style="COLOR: #c00000"&gt;Whosoever offers his morning (fajr) prayer in congregation, then remains seated making the dhikr of Allah until the sun rises, and thereafter offers two rakats, they will receive the reward of performing a Hajj and Umrah&lt;/SPAN&gt;&lt;FONT color=#000000&gt;’&lt;/FONT&gt;&lt;/I&gt;&lt;FONT color=#000000&gt;. Some say that&lt;/FONT&gt;&lt;SPAN&gt;&lt;FONT color=#000000&gt;  &lt;/FONT&gt;&lt;STRONG&gt;Salat al-Ishraq&lt;/STRONG&gt;&lt;/SPAN&gt;&lt;FONT color=#000000&gt; and &lt;/FONT&gt;&lt;SPAN style="COLOR: #c00000"&gt;&lt;STRONG&gt;Salat al-Duha are the same pray&lt;/STRONG&gt;&lt;/SPAN&gt;&lt;FONT color=#000000&gt;.&lt;SPAN style="mso-spacerun: yes"&gt;  &lt;/SPAN&gt;But they are not, they are &lt;/FONT&gt;&lt;SPAN style="COLOR: #c00000"&gt;&lt;STRONG&gt;two separate prayers&lt;/STRONG&gt;&lt;/SPAN&gt;&lt;FONT color=#000000&gt;. The recommended time for offering &lt;/FONT&gt;&lt;SPAN style="COLOR: #c00000"&gt;&lt;STRONG&gt;Ishraq prayer&lt;/STRONG&gt;&lt;/SPAN&gt;&lt;FONT color=#000000&gt; is 15 mins &lt;/FONT&gt;&lt;SPAN style="COLOR: #c00000"&gt;&lt;STRONG&gt;immediately after sunrise&lt;/STRONG&gt;&lt;/SPAN&gt;&lt;FONT color=#000000&gt;, &lt;o:p&gt;&lt;/o:p&gt;&lt;/FONT&gt;&lt;/FONT&gt;&lt;/FONT&gt;&lt;/SPAN&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P style="TEXT-ALIGN: justify; MARGIN: 0cm 0cm 10pt" class=MsoNormal&gt;&lt;SPAN style="LINE-HEIGHT: 115%; FONT-FAMILY: 'Trebuchet MS','sans-serif'; FONT-SIZE: 10pt; mso-bidi-font-family: Calibri; mso-bidi-theme-font: minor-latin" lang=EN-US&gt;&lt;FONT face=Arial&gt;&lt;FONT color=#000000&gt;whilst &lt;/FONT&gt;&lt;SPAN style="COLOR: #c00000"&gt;&lt;STRONG&gt;Duha prayer&lt;/STRONG&gt;&lt;/SPAN&gt;&lt;FONT color=#000000&gt; (which is also called &lt;/FONT&gt;&lt;SPAN style="COLOR: #c00000"&gt;&lt;STRONG&gt;Chasht prayer in Urdu&lt;/STRONG&gt;&lt;/SPAN&gt;&lt;FONT color=#000000&gt;) is offered later on before &lt;/FONT&gt;&lt;SPAN style="COLOR: #c00000"&gt;Zawwal- the Zenith&lt;/SPAN&gt;&lt;FONT color=#000000&gt;. The "soul," as commonly used in the Qur'an, means "ego" or "one's personality." &l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;In the Qur'an, Allah explains the two aspects of soul: the one inspiring evil and wicked deeds, and the other, guarding against every inculcation of evil. The Qur'an explains this in Surat ash-Shams:&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;[b]By the Soul, and the proportion and order given to it; and its enlightenment as to its wrong and its right; truly, he succeeds that purifies it, and he fails that corrupts it! (Surat ash-Shams: 7-10) &lt;br&gt;[/b]&lt;br&gt; &lt;br&gt;As is evident from the above verses, evil exists in every man's soul. However, he who purifies his soul will attain salvation. Believers do not surrender their selves to the evil in their soul; they simply avoid it with the guidance of Allah's inspiration. As the Prophet Yusuf (as) said: [b]"Not that I am free from sin: man's soul is prone to evil-except his to whom my Lord has shown mercy…" (Surah Yusuf: 53)[/b], provides the right manner of thinking for a believer. &l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;Since the soul "is prone to evil," a believer must always remain vigilant about his soul. As the Prophet Muhammad (saas) also said, "the greatest struggle is the struggle against one's self (nafs)." The soul unceasingly tempts a person and never earns him Allah's approval. As it does all these things it tries to present alluring alternatives. A believer, however, thanks to his fear of Allah, is not deceived by this "misleading" attribute of the soul. He always turns towards what is right to lead a life in compliance with Allah's Will. Such is the attitude of a wise person as opposed to a foolish one, as the Prophet (saas) said: &l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;A wise person is one who keeps a watch over his bodily desires and passions, and checks himself from that which is harmful and strives for that which will benefit him after death; and a foolish person is one who subordinates himself to his cravings and desires and expects from Allah the fulfilment of his futile desires.</description><pubDate>Sat, 16 Jan 2010 10:14:26 GMT</pubDate><dc:creator>yusuf2010</dc:creator></item><item><title>Believer's Compassion</title><link>http://www.yanabi.com/forum/Topic356377-160-1.aspx</link><description>[b]Muhammad is the Messenger of Allah, and those who are with him are fierce to the unbelievers, merciful to one another. Whosoever does like you have done, Almighty Allah will forgive his all sins.” (Tafseer Roohul Bayaan).&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;Sayyiduna Imam Hasan (radi Allahu anhu) said Whosoever hears the Mu’azzin say’ “ Ash hadu Ana Muhammadur Rasoolullah” and says “Marhaba bi Habibi” and “Quratu Aini Muhammad Bin Abdullah” and then kisses his both the thumbs and keeps it on his eyes, then he will never become blind and his eyes will never be sore.” (Maqaaside Husna).&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;—-&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;In fiqh, the discussion of taqbil al-unbulatayn wa mash al-’aynayn is usually found at the end of Bab Adhan. Certain gestures performed during the adhan, and specifically the ‘amal of kissing the thumbs and wiping the eye, are something known to Shafi’is, and there can be no objection whatsoever by our jurists (and any jurists for that matter) to those wishing to perform this ‘amal: as far as we are concerned, it is classified under the category of the Fada’il al-A’mal [I'anat, 1:243; al-Jurdani, Fath al-'Allam, 2:140-1].&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;Among its legal bases ['ilal] is that it is a Sunna of the first Khalifa of the Messenger of Allah (may Allah’s blessings and peace be upon him!) [i.e., an Athar of the first Khalifa], and it is also based on a number of Hadiths, of which the most well known is the Hadith of Abu Bakr (may Allah be well pleased with him!).&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;Full Post: [url=http://higherstations.wordpress.com/2009/10/21/forgotten-sunnah-kissing-thumbs-during-the-athan/]http://higherstations.wordpress.com/2009/10/21/forgotten-sunnah-kissing-thumbs-during-the-athan/[/url]</description><pubDate>Wed, 21 Oct 2009 04:20:24 GMT</pubDate><dc:creator>Adil Hakkani</dc:creator></item><item><title>Demons Behind The Music Industry Ex Illuminati explains</title><link>http://www.yanabi.com/forum/Topic339707-160-1.aspx</link><description>as salamalekum&lt;P&gt;:w00t:&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;I upload this video to help spread real underground info and pass it throughout the net to those who dont yet know...The truth is even the new age movement is being manipulated and was set up. This makes the person feel good and their mood is conveyed back to you - Which helps you feel good, too.'&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;THE SUNNAH&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;When someone wanted to talk to our peloved Prophet, May Allah bless him and grant him peace, he would turn toward him fully and face him directly. Aisha, Allah be pleased with her, states, 'When the Messenger, May Allah bless him and grant him peace, spoke it was clear and every listening person could understand (what he said).'&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;Anas , May Allah be pleased with him, stated that, 'When the Prophet. May Allah bless him and grant him peace, would talk, he repeated it (that which he said) three times so that it could be understood.'&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;Jabir Ibn AbdAllah, May Allah be pleased with him, says, "After I accepted Islam, The Messenger of Allah, May Allah bless him and grant him peace, never prohibited me from attending his assemblies. Whenever he saw me he smiled."&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;To smile at a Muslim brother is charity.
